I'm in haplogroup H3h with FMS, tested about 6 years ago. I've been monitoring my matches to see if any can be tied in to my known genealogy which goes back to early Dutch settlers of Schenectady, NY on my mtDNA line, without any success. Some of my exact matches are from Sweden and Russia which must be pre-genealogical connections. I have a total of 140 matches of GD 0-3, with 23 at GD 0. Last week my 23rd GD 0 match showed up and she has an ancestor who has the same last name (Scott) as my 3rd great grandmother, they were born a year apart, and lived as adults in Warren County in upstate NY. Since they were born around 1802-3 there are no census records to show them together and I can find no birth or baptism records showing names of parents, but I have other evidence for the parents of my ancestor. My match has found none for hers.
I think the odds would be very small that this is just a coincidence and these two women were not sisters. I'd welcome other opinions.
